The epithelium that comprises the mucosa of the stomach is c. Simple columnar.

Here's a step-by-step explanation:

  1. The stomach is part of the digestive tract, which is lined by a mucous membrane.
  2. This mucous membrane is made up of epithelial cells, which are the body's first line of defense against harmful substances.
  3. The type of epithelial cells found in the stomach is the simple columnar epithelium.
  4. Simple columnar epithelium is made up of a single layer of tall and narrow cells.
  5. These cells have the ability to secrete and absorb substances, which is crucial for the stomach's role in digestion. They secrete mucus that protects the stomach lining from the acidic gastric juices.
  6. Therefore, the correct answer is c. Simple columnar.
